    CropIt is the essential photo editing tool for the Blackberry.

    Crop your pictures to the perfect size and have only what you want in the frame with no unnecessary background in the pictures.

    CropIt allows you to change your pictures around before uploading them to social networking sites such as Facebook or Flickr.

    Don't want to bother with the zoom when you take a picture? Dont worry about it, take wide angle shots and CropIt will help you get the picture you really want.

    Follow Changelog at the developers web site

    All upgrades will be free once you purchase initially!

    Features:

    * Crop any picture on your phone
    * Customized save location on your Device or Memory Card
    * Save to JPEG or PNG
    * Quick crop with keyboard shortcuts
    * Undo your crop and try again
    * Preview crop area before cropping
